TESTS FOR DETERMINING THE SERVO TORQUE. We are sending you some 'set up' spring balances which we should like you to fit to your cars to determine the torque multiplication. They should be fitted as shewn in the accompanying sketch. Call the top spring balance 'A' (the one connected with the pedal) and the bottom one 'B'. We usually take about 15 sets of readings with vary- ing degrees of braking for one test. A point to note is that the brake pedal should be released before the car comes to a stand- still.
